What is recorded here
In pasture, on relatively flat terrain. Oval slightly raised area (40.5m N-S; 36.5m E-W) enclosed by earth and stone bank (int. H 0.44m; ext. H 0.97m). Dry-stone field wall defines site WSW->NNW; collapsed wall mostly obscures earth and stone bank N->S. Modern entrance (Wth 3.3m) at SSW flanked by two concrete piers. Cattle gap (Wth 2.4m) at NNW. Field fences abut external face of bank at NNE, SSE and SW. Level interior under pasture.

A local fairy fort (ringfort/rath); wider significance not recorded.
